Incident Overview

Authorities were called to Ventura Boulevard early on Thursday morning following reports of a man seen walking in his underwear. Upon arrival, officers from the Los Angeles Police Department (LAPD) allege that Lil Nas X, whose real name is Montero Lamar Hill, charged at them, leading to his arrest on suspicion of battery.

Following the altercation, he was transported to a hospital for treatment related to a suspected overdose. This incident has garnered significant media attention, with unverified footage emerging online reportedly showing the rapper dancing in the street and inviting passersby to join him. The video, shared by TMZ, captures a chaotic scene that has raised questions about the rapper's wellbeing.

Background of Lil Nas X

Born on 9 April 1999 in Lithia Springs, Georgia, Lil Nas X rose to fame with his breakout hit "Old Town Road" in 2019. The song achieved tremendous success, becoming the first song to spend 17 consecutive weeks at number one on the Billboard Hot 100 chart. His innovative blend of country and rap not only earned him commercial success but also made him a significant figure in the conversation around genre and representation in music.

In addition to his chart-topping success, Lil Nas X made history as the first openly gay man to win a Country Music Association award, demonstrating his influence beyond just music. His debut album, Montero, released in September 2021, solidified his place in the music industry, receiving critical acclaim and further showcasing his unique artistic vision.

Controversies and Public Perception

Throughout his career, Lil Nas X has been no stranger to controversy. His music videos, particularly for singles like "Montero (Call Me By Your Name)," have sparked heated debates, especially among conservative commentators. Critics have labelled the video's themes as "depraved" and "evil," while Lil Nas X has often responded with a combination of humour and defiance. He famously released a fake apology video that juxtaposed his apologies with scenes from his provocative performances, indicating his unwillingness to conform to traditional expectations.

His unapologetic approach to both his art and identity has endeared him to many fans while alienating others. As a result, he has become a polarising figure within the entertainment landscape, often using social media to engage with fans and critics alike. His ability to turn criticism into viral moments has helped him maintain relevance in a rapidly changing industry.
